Groupon shares drop below $20 IPO price

Bad news for Groupon: Shares in the deal company are falling apart.

Groupon went public not even a month ago. You know them, the big daily deal site where you can get coupons for everything from surfing lessons to cupcakes.

Their stock debuted at $20 a share and went as high as $31 on that first day.

Well Forbes points out that for the week Groupon is down 35 percent with a stock price hovering around $17 a share. Not the kind of discount investors were hoping for.
